Plate ca. 1824-34 James and Ralph Clews British This blue and white transfer-printed earthenware plate made by the Staffordshire firm of James & Ralph Clews features a view of the triumphal landing of General Lafayette (1757-1834) in New York Harbor on August 16, 1824 where he was met by the American naval ship Chancellor Livingston" and escorted to Castle Garden for a huge celebration by thousands of patriotic well-wishers.. Plate. British (American market). ca. 1824-34. Earthenware, transfer-printed. Made in Staffordshire, Stoke-on-Trent, England
